[20672]  Outlook Expressのメッセ−ジル−ルについて
投稿者:BPA さん   2002-01-26 21:50:42
Outlook Expressで下記のようなメッセ−ジル−ルを
作成したとします

  件名に”A”を含む場合
  A(フォルダ)に移動する。

するとメ−ルデ−タは実際には、受信トレイ.dbx から
A.dbxに移動するだけですが、これをHD上に作成した
実際の”A”というフォルダに移動したいのですが
なにか良い方法は無いでしょうか。
いい方法がありましたらどなたか教えてください。
  1. さん   2002-01-26 23:22:17
    OEのAフォルダの内容をそのままWindowsのAフォルダにコピーできますよ。
  2. BPA さん   2002-01-26 23:44:45
    谷さんありがとうございます。少し説明が足りなかったようですが、要は自動処理で上記の様な処理が出来ない物かという質問です。
  3. とつきかんな さん   2002-01-26 23:49:01
     メールが振り分けられた段階というわけにはいきませんが、dbxファイルを任意のフォルダにコピーするようバッチファイルを書いておいて、Windows起動時にスタートアップで実行するというのはどうでしょう。これなら、前回OS終了時までに振り分けられたメールはコピーできます。
     Outlook Expressの保存フォルダにA.dbxが存在すると困るという場合はこれでは駄目ですが。
  4. DEN_EI@管理人 さん   2002-01-27 03:32:47
    >するとメ−ルデ−タは実際には、受信トレイ.dbx から
    >A.dbxに移動するだけですが、これをHD上に作成した
    >実際の”A”というフォルダに移動したいのですが
    誤解が生じやすそうな内容ですので確認したいのですが、
    例えのメッセージルール「メールデータ→(OE)受信トレイ.dbx→(OE)A.dbx」
    実現したい方法「メールデータ→(OE)受信トレイ.dbx→(HDDの本当のディレクトリ)A(に1つ1つメールを保存)」
    と言う事を言っていますか?

    だとしたら…多分無理だと思います(^^;。
    「メールデータ→(OE)受信トレイ.dbx→(OE)A.dbx→後でA.dbx内のメールを全部(HDDの本当のディレクトリ)Aに(*.emlファイルとして)手動保存」するしか…。
    #1つ1つのメールデータを保存する方法は自動処理で出来なさそうですね。
    #そういう支援ユーティリティがあるかもしれませんけど…。

    「メールデータ→(OE)受信トレイ.dbx→(OE)A.dbx→後でA.dbxを(HDDの本当のディレクトリ)Aにコピー」なら
    とっつきかんなさんの方法で基本的にOKですし、「タスク」を利用すればもっと時間指定・回数など
    きめ細かく指定できます(dbxファイルを「コピー」でなく「移動」の場合は、OE起動時は無理かも)。
  5. BPA さん   2002-01-27 09:33:19
    DEN_EI@管理人さんわかりやすい解説を付けていただきありがとうございます。
    質問の主旨はDEN_EI@管理人さんの解説の通りなのですが、やはりむりですか。
    実は会社で、システムからしばらくの間メ−ルの受信はこのPC1台のみでやってください
    と言われて、もうしばらくたつのですが、その指定されたPCが私の机に近いもので、自動的に私が振り分け役になってしまいました。
    メ−ルが入るたびに仕事が中断で何か出来ない物かと質問を出しました。
    あきらめて振り分け役をもう少し続けます。
  6. カーネルアンドピーチ さん   2002-01-27 11:11:06
    参考までに・・・。
    >システムからしばらくの間メ−ルの受信はこのPC1台のみでやってくださいと言われて
    という理由は何でしょうか?
    もしも、メールからのウィルスの侵入を防ぐためのもので有れば、
    法人向けのプロバイダーで、
    ウイルスに感染したメールを感知して全て弾くサービスを行っている所が有ります。
  7. DEN_EI@管理人 さん   2002-01-27 16:53:52
    >実は会社で、システムからしばらくの間メ−ルの受信はこのPC1台のみでやってください
    >と言われて、もうしばらくたつのですが、その指定されたPCが私の机に近いもので、自動的に私が振り分け役になってしまいました。
    なるほど…お話の雰囲気からするとこれは「複数のユーザー(メールアカウント)のメール受信を
    指定のPC1台でやってほしいと言われている」と言う事でしょうか。
    もしそうでしたら、この場合は「ユーザーごとにOEを使う」方が本来の方法です。
    実現方法としては
    ・OS(&ネットワーク)のユーザーをメールアカウント人数分用意(追加)して、
     メールを使用するときは自分のユーザーでOSにログオンしてからOEを起動する。
    ・ネットワークでドメイン管理などされていて、OS(&ネットワーク)のユーザーを用意することが
     面倒&よく分からない(^^;場合は、1ユーザー内のOEで「ユーザーの切替」でメールアカウント分対応する
     OEの「ファイル」−「ユーザー」−「ユーザーの追加」でユーザーを追加していけば、
     OEのユーザー人数分メールデータフォルダ(受信.dbx等を含むディレクトリ)が新たに作成されます。
     OEのユーザーを切り替える時は「ファイル」−「ユーザーの切替」で。
    #通常はOEを1ユーザー1人で使う場面が殆どなので、「メインユーザー」と言う
    #ディフォルトユーザーを無意識で使っているはずです。

    あと出来れば、OSの種類(Win9x系/WinNT系)なども明記した方が良いですよ。
  8. かねやす さん   2002-01-28 19:05:23
    そのPCにpmsなり、BlackJumboDogなりのメールサーバを立てて、割り振ってもらう
    というのは?。受信メールに別名が振ってあるなら、上記2つのソフトのいずれも対
    応出来るかも。但し、社内→社外へのメール送信はさせないようにご注意を。

    #出来なかったらごめんなさい。

    http://homepage2.nifty.com/spw/
    あら、pmsは検索にひっかからないや...